Manchin joining Biden, Garner on West Virginia trip

U.S. Sen. Joe Manchin, D-W.Va. (Office of U.S. Sen. Joe Manchin)

CHARLESTON, W.Va. — U.S. Sen. Joe Manchin, D-W.Va., will join First Lady Jill Biden and actress Jennifer Garner on their trip Thursday to West Virginia.

Biden, Garner and Manchin will visit a coronavirus vaccination site at Capital High School, where the three will also deliver remarks.

The first lady and Garner were originally scheduled to visit Arnoldsburg Elementary School in Calhoun County; the school system in on remote learning because of coronavirus-related issues.

The three will arrive and depart from Charleston’s Yeager Airport, and the three will speak to members of the West Virginia National Guard before leaving West Virginia.
